Explanation:

Two figures are similar if their angle measures are the same and corresponding sides are proportional.

The bottom left figure has angle measures of 37°, 53° and 90°. The bottom right figure has the same angle measures.

The sides of the bottom left figure have lengths of 3, 4 and 5. The corresponding sides of the bottom right figure have lengths of 6, 8 and 10. This means they are proportional.

The figures are similar.
